Файловый сервер на Hyperledger Composer? - PullRequest
0 голосов
/ 03 октября 2018

Я только начинающий в HyperLedger Composer и Fabrics.

После учебника IBM в разделе 'https://www.coursera.org/learn/ibm-blockchain-essentials-for-developers'

У меня есть один быстрый вопрос:

Как создатьФайловый сервер с использованием Hyperledger Composer?Это возможно сейчас или нет?любая обратная связь будет очень полезна.

Ответы [ 2 ]

0 голосов
/ 04 октября 2018

Принимая во внимание технологию, сохранение файла в Hyperledger Fabric и использование его в качестве файлового сервера не будет хорошей стратегией.

Вы хешируете исходный файл и используете фабрику гиперледжеров для хранения значения хеш-функции и других данных, необходимых для системы и для проверки.Но вы должны использовать другой сервер для хранения файлов.

Нечто подобное будет работать, я думаю: Пример системы: Изображение enter image description here

При любых изменениях, обновлениях или изменениях версий вы сохраняете новый файл на сервере, создаете новый хэш и добавляете данные в новую запись в фабрике hyperledger.

0 голосов
/ 03 октября 2018

Использование Composer и Fabric в качестве файлового сервера было бы необычным, и из-за природы Fabric в качестве распределенной книги он может плохо работать в качестве файлового сервера.

Есть и другие вопросы и ответы вПереполнение стека при хранении изображений и т. Д. С использованием кодировки base64, например this .

В зависимости от вашего варианта использования может оказаться более целесообразным сохранить некоторый хэш-файл в Fabric, что позволит вам доказать действительность файла, сохраняя при этом сам файл на выделенном файловом сервере.

...